I recently placed Potenza pole position 3's on my 07 speed 6 and now I am noticing that the steering wheel has a slight vibration (visibly see it shaking) when I hit 70mph and then at 90mph...

I had the tires balanced at the dealership assuming they would do a good job and I am a repeat customer.

Is it possible to balance tires to a perfect level or will there always be speed(s) where there will be a small (annoying) vibration??

first of all slow down.... Now that thats out of the way a vibration in the steering wheels will denote a out of bal issue ir a bent rim issue... Get a road force bal done would be your best bet...

Is a road force balance the type of balancing machine and is that considered the best out there...just would like to know what to ask as far as type of balancers before I bring it into a reputable shop...

Road Force balancing is the type of balancing you want done to your tires. Its a bit more expensive than regular balancing but in the end worth the $$... Only problem is not all shops have the RF balance machine due to its cost (more than $14000)...
